标签归档:字段数

使用sql脚本获取mysql中指定数据表拥有的字段数的方法分享


摘要:
今天同事让我数一下”****”表有多少个字段?
看到这个问题,脑袋顿时一嗡,这该咋办呢,这张表的字段数,一眼看不到边啊,
通过多方资料的查阅,才知道可以通过查询系统定义表获取数据表中拥有的字段数 ,如下所示:
实验环境:mysql



实现思路:
通过检索mysql中的information_schema.COLUMNS数据表,获取相应的列数信息

   ----每列显示一行信息
   select  *  from information_schema.COLUMNS
            where TABLE_SCHEMA='数据库名称' and table_name='数据表名称'
   
   ---显示汇总列信息
   select count(*) from information_schema.COLUMNS
         where TABLE_SCHEMA='数据库名称' and table_name='数据表名称'